#b2682f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2682f is composed of 69.8% red, 40.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.6%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 26.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 44.1%. #b2682f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d05e with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#b2682f color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#b2682f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b2682f has RGB values of R:178, G:104,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.74,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11692079.

Hex triplet b2682f #b2682f
RGB Decimal 178, 104, 47 rgb(178,104,47)
RGB Percent 69.8, 40.8, 18.4 rgb(69.8%,40.8%,18.4%)
CMYK 0, 42, 74, 30
HSL 26.1°, 58.2, 44.1 hsl(26.1,58.2%,44.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 26.1°, 73.6, 69.8
Web Safe 996633 #996633
CIE-LAB 51.351, 24.951, 43.502
XYZ 23.824, 19.573, 5.212
xyY 0.49, 0.403, 19.573
CIE-LCH 51.351, 50.15, 60.163
CIE-LUV 51.351, 58.94, 40.436
Hunter-Lab 44.241, 18.702, 23.983
Binary 10110010, 01101000, 00101111

Shades and Tints of #b2682f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2682f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75706c is the less saturated color, while #dd6204 is the most saturated one.
